Southeast Asia Gears for Cyberwarfare, India Turns to Artificial Intelligence
Tensions in the global political atmosphere are starting to raise concerns about the possibility of cyberwarfare in multiple countries. This is pushing Southeast Asia and countries such as India to amp up their cybersecurity game.
